#c39c6c - Twine Hex Color Code

#C39C6C (Twine) - RGB 195, 156, 108 Color Information

#c39c6c Conversion Table

HEX Triplet C3, 9C, 6C
RGB Decimal 195, 156, 108
RGB Octal 303, 234, 154
RGB Percent 76.5%, 61.2%, 42.4%
RGB Binary 11000011, 10011100, 1101100
CMY 0.235, 0.388, 0.576
CMYK 0, 20, 45, 24

Color spaces of #C39C6C Twine - RGB(195, 156, 108)

HSV (or HSB) 33°, 45°, 76°
HSL 33°, 42°, 59°
Web Safe #cc9966
XYZ 37.101, 36.462, 19.270
CIE-Lab 66.871, 8.211, 30.593
xyY 0.400, 0.393, 36.462
Decimal 12819564

#c39c6c - RGB(195, 156, 108) - Twine Color FAQ

What is the color code for Twine?

Hex color code for Twine color is #c39c6c. RGB color code for twine color is rgb(195, 156, 108).

What is the RGB value of #c39c6c?

The RGB value corresponding to the hexadecimal color code #c39c6c is rgb(195, 156, 108). These values represent the intensities of the red, green, and blue components of the color, respectively. Here, '195' indicates the intensity of the red component, '156' represents the green component's intensity, and '108' denotes the blue component's intensity. Combined in these specific proportions, these three color components create the color represented by #c39c6c.

What does RGB 195,156,108 mean?

The RGB color 195, 156, 108 represents a dull and muted shade of Red. The websafe version of this color is hex cc9966. This color might be commonly referred to as a shade similar to Twine.
